When do I use my RDP username to log in, and when do I use my RDP email?
Answer
Several services at Red Deer Polytechnic require you to login in order to authenticate your identity.
RDP Username and Email
Some services require you to log in using your RDP username, while others use your RDP email. In either case, your password is the same.
In addition, some services require you to use multi-factor authentication (MFA) when logging in off-campus.
Third-Party Services
Some third-party services affiliated with RDP require different login credentials, such as your Library (NEOS) account and the Parking ePermit system.
